Introduction

The BExS120D and BExS110D are second generation
flameproof sounders which are certified to the European
Standards EN 50014: 1992 and EN 50018: 1994 and meet
the requirements of the ATEX directive 94/9/EC. The
sounders produce loud warning signals and can be used in
hazardous areas where potentially flammable atmospheres
may be present. Thirty-two different first stage alarm sounds
can be selected by internal switches, and each one can be
externally changed to a second or third stage alarm sound
(

see tone table on Page 4

). The BExS120D unit produces

output levels in the 117dB(A) range and the BExS110D unit
produces output levels in the 110dB(A) range. Both sounders
can be used in Zone 1 and Zone 2 areas with gases in
groups IIA, IIB and IIC and temperature Classifications of T1,
T2, T3 and T4.

Installation Requirements

The sounders must be installed in accordance with the latest
issues

of

the

relevant

parts

of

the

BS

EN 60079

specifications

or

the

equivalent

IEC

specifications

Selection,

Installation

and

maintenance

of

electrical

apparatus for use in potentially explosive atmospheres (other
than mining applications or explosive processing and
manufacture):-

BS EN 60079-14 : 1997

Electrical Installations in Hazardous
Areas (other than mines)

BS EN 60079-10 : 1996

Classification of Hazardous Areas

The installation of the units must also be in accordance with
any local codes that may apply and should only be carried
out by a competent electrical engineer who has the
necessary training.

Zones, Gas Group, Category and Temperature
Classification

The BExS120D and BExS110D sounders have been certified
EEx d IIC T4 (Tamb. –50 to +55ºC). This means that the units
can be installed in locations with the following conditions:-

Area Classification:

Zone 1

Explosive gas air mixture likely to occur in
normal operation.

Zone 2

Explosive gas air mixture not likely to occur,
and if it does, it will only exist for a short time.

Gas Groupings:

Group IIA

Propane

Group IIB

Ethylene

Group IIC

Hydrogen and Acetylene

Equipment Category:

2G

Temperature Classification:

T1

400

o

C

T2

300

o

C

T3

200

o

C

T4

135

o

C

Ambient Temperature Range:

-50

°

C to +55

°

C

Sounder Location and Mounting

The location of the sounders should be made with due regard
to the area over which the warning signal must be audible.
The sounders should only be fixed to services that can carry
the weight of the unit.
